Three species of farinose ferns traditionally included in the large, polymorphic genus Cheilanthes Swartz are transferred to the genus Notholaena R. Brown as N. aureolina Yatskievych & Arbelaez, N. jaliscana Yatskievych & Arbelaez, and N. ochracea (Hooker) Yatskievych & Arbelaez. Additionally, a Central American novelty is described as a new species, N. montielae Yatskievych & Arbelaez, with a type from Nicaragua.
